Peach Tree Pruning in Allentown, PA
Peach Tree Pruning services involve carefully trimming and shaping peach trees to promote healthy growth, improve fruit production, and maintain the overall appearance of the tree. This service typically covers a variety of projects, including removing dead or diseased branches, reducing overcrowding, and shaping trees to ensure proper sunlight exposure and air circulation. Homeowners often seek pruning to enhance the safety of their property, prevent branch breakage, or prepare trees for seasonal changes, making it important to understand the specific needs of their peach trees before requesting service.
Property owners interested in peach tree pruning should consider factors such as the age and size of the trees, the desired shape or fruit yield, and any existing issues like pest damage or disease. Clarifying these details can help determine the scope of the work needed and ensure the pruning is performed effectively. Proper pruning not only supports the health and productivity of the trees but also contributes to the overall aesthetics of the landscape.

Peach Tree Pruning Questions
What is peach tree pruning? Peach tree pruning involves removing dead or overgrown branches to promote healthy growth and better fruit production.
When is the best time to prune a peach tree? The ideal time to prune a peach tree is during late winter or early spring before new growth begins.
Why is pruning important for peach trees? Pruning helps improve air circulation, reduces disease risk, and encourages larger, sweeter fruit.
What tools are used for peach tree pruning? Sharp pruning shears and saws are typically used to safely remove unwanted branches and maintain the tree’s shape.
